Message And they help the system perform as intended. The secondary function is tweeter protection. If a tweeter plays too low, it'll bottom and destroy itself in minutes.

That being said, there is a definite possibility the Alpine crossovers use better quality crossover components internally than the Pioneer. Size isn't a true indicator, unless you can see inside them. Air-core inductors are better for sound quality, and they're larger than ferrite core inductors, which the Pioneers use (judging by the photos on Pioneer's website). The new model of the Type-R components use an air core inductor, and the ACIs have been around for decades, so it's not likely a recent switch.

In 10 words or less, I'd try the Alpine crossovers for an easier installation. Definitely won't be worse quality wise, and the cross over point (not listed on either model) is probably within 500Hz or so of each other.
